Micro-Loans, Insecticide-Treated Bednets, and Malaria: Evidence from a Randomized Controlled Trial in Orissa, India

Alessandro Tarozzi; Aprajit Mahajan; Brian G. Blackburn; Dan Kopf; Lakshmi Krishnan; Joanne Yoong · 2014 · American Economic Review

Abstract (excerpt)

We describe findings from the first large-scale cluster randomized controlled trial in a developing country that evaluates the uptake of a health-protecting technology, insecticide-treated bednets (ITNs), through micro-consumer loans, as…
